Joely Richardson Joins Tudors Cast

LOS ANGELES: Nip/Tuck star Joely Richardson has been cast as Catherine Parr, Henry VIII’s sixth and last wife, for the fourth season of Showtime’s The Tudors.

Richardson joins the cast of the acclaimed drama for its final season, currently filming in Dublin for a 2010 premiere. Richardson will portray Parr in five episodes of the show. The actress, the daughter of Vanessa Redgrave and Tony Richardson, has appeared in films such as The Patriot, I’ll Do Anything and The Last Mimzy, but is perhaps best known in the U.S. for her role on FX’s Nip/Tuck

The new season will chronicle the final days of the king—portrayed by Jonathan Rhys-Meyers—including his war against France and his last two wives (Catherine Howard, played by Tamzin Merchant, and Catherine Parr.)
